What is Alopecia?

Alopecia areata is a type of hair loss that can occur on the scalp or any hair-bearing area of the body. It is characterized by the sudden appearance of circular bald patches, also known as patchy hair loss. This condition can affect individuals of any age or gender, typically occurring before the age of 30. It is not contagious, and the underlying cause involves the immune system attacking the hair follicles, resulting in hair fall. While hair often grows back, it can also experience recurring periods of loss. In some cases, the condition may persist for many years.
